SENIOR MANAGEMENT ANALYST I - SES - 65000013

The State of Florida's Department of Elder Affairs is dedicated to promoting the well-being of Florida's seniors. They are seeking a Senior Management Analyst I to manage operational activities, ensure compliance with regulations, and oversee the ombudsman program.

Government Administration

Responsibilities

Manages operational activities and processes to meet specific, measurable objectives to ensure compliance with statewide and operational goals, objectives, state and federal requirements, and internal policies and procedures including the review and approval of ombudsmen cases and assessment documentation
Trains ombudsmen in collaboration with the district council chair, or designee, to fulfill all program certification and continuing education training requirements
Participates in the development and implementation of volunteer recruitment and retention initiatives in collaboration with the district membership workgroup
Provides consultation and assistance to volunteers, management and staff in the operation and execution of federal and state mandated responsibilities
Resolves programmatic, administrative and operational issues in consultation with program supervisors
Investigates and resolves long-term care facility residents' complaints; identifies significant individual and systemic problems affecting residents problems by bringing them to the attention of appropriate public agencies; monitors and comments on the development and implementation of federal, state, and local long-term care laws and policies; obtains access to long-term care facilities and to residents' records to investigate and resolve complaints; and protects the confidentiality of residents' records, complainants' identities, and ombudsman files
Serves on interdisciplinary staff teams as directed with the Agency for Health Care Administration, the Department of Children and Families, and other entities to develop optimum resolutions to related issues or barriers to quality provision of services; carries out the implementation of solutions within the program and the community
Manages the ombudsman program web-based documentation system and completes documentation for submission to the National Ombudsman Reporting System
As manager of the ombudsman records, reviews and approves ombudsmen documentation
Manages the district office including consultations to long-term care facility staff and private individuals, information and referral, and financial tracking
Supervises staff and volunteers to ensure compliance with federal, state and program mandates
Performs other duties as assigned by the State Ombudsman, or designee
